Wood is recruiting for a Expeditor II to join its Projects team focusing on delivering across FEED and Detail design scopes of work. In this role, you will be responsible for the Expediting of Purchase Orders to ensure delivery on time and within project schedules/purchase order terms.

Responsible for coordinating all aspects of desk and field expediting as determined by project strategy, processes and procedures.

Ensure personnel carry out expediting activities have a clear understanding of processes and procedures.

Position is based in Oman for a long-term assignment.

Responsibilities

The Expeditor II will be responsible:

  • Establishes priorities, assigns workloads and manages expediting team performance
  • Review and manage the more difficult and complex aspects of the expediting workload.
  • Has detailed understanding of the supplier delivery obligations form the terms and conditions of purchase
  • Review and interpret supplier production plans/schedules, identify delivery improvement opportunities and negotiate delivery improvements / slippage recovery plans
  • Creation of daily expediting reports in materials management system.
  • Expediting of purchase orders daily with priority focus.
  • Updating of materials management system with the expediting status of Purchase Orders.
  • Continually set expediting follow up dates in materials management system.
  • Obtain quotations for field expediting plans and C.V.’s of 3rd party expediting providers.
  • Place purchase order for 3rd party expediting services.
  • Liaise with field expediting suppliers to co-ordinate expediting visits.
  • Receive, review and issue field expediting progress reports and update system accordingly.
  • Review expediting reports to confirm status of orders, sub-orders and validate the agreed manufacturing schedules.
  • Monitor the progress of receipt and return of supplier documentation.
  • Notifying Supply Chain Manager of any potential schedule slippages.
  • Negotiate improved delivery / recovery plans where required.
  • Visit suppliers on request of the SCM and Material Manager on the project.
